Solution Overview

Problem

Users engaged in virtual reality environments face difficulties in interacting with the real world or commanding other devices without disrupting their virtual experience, as existing solutions either require removing the VR headset or are limited to specific applications.

Innovation Solution

A method that detects an activation command to activate a digital assistant on a disparate device, establishes a connection, and receives user commands to perform actions within the virtual environment, allowing seamless interaction with real-world devices while immersed in VR.

Data Source

PatentUS12047453B2Digital assistant utilization in a virtual environment
Publication Date: 2024.07.23 LENOVO SWITZERLAND INTERNATIONAL GMBH

AI summary

One embodiment provides a method, including: detecting, while in a virtual environment effectuated by a virtual reality device, an activation command to activate a digital assistant embodied on a disparate digital assistant device; establishing a connection with the disparate digital assistant device; receiving, subsequent to the establishing and at the virtual reality device, a user command directed toward the digital assistant; and performing, using the digital assistant while in the virtual environment, an action corresponding to the user command.
